Evaluando propuestas

Oracle Apex - Desarrollo de una aplicación de control de asistencia de personal.

Publicado el 24 Diciembre, 2024 en Programación y Tecnología

Sobre este proyecto

Abierto

Estamos en busca de un freelancer experimentado y especializado en Oracle APEX para el desarrollo de una aplicación de control de asistencia de personal. El sistema deberá estar diseñado para registrar de manera precisa el ingreso y salida de los empleados, controlar los tiempos de refrigerio, gestionar los cambios de sección y turno, y generar reportes detallados de asistencia, tardanzas, y otros informes clave relacionados con la gestión de personal.

Requisitos del proyecto:

1. Registro de asistencia preciso:

1.1 Ingreso y salida de los empleados.
1.2 Control de tiempos de refrigerio.
1.3 Gestión de cambios de sección y turno.

2. Adaptabilidad según características específicas de la empresa:

2.1 Uso de tarjetas de proximidad y dispositivos biométricos para plantas.
2.2 Control de dispositivos móviles con coordenadas GPS para tiendas.

3. Generación de reportes:

3.1 Reportes detallados de asistencia, incidencias de tardanza, y horas trabajadas.
3.2 Informes personalizados sobre incidencias de asistencia y otros aspectos clave de la gestión laboral.

4. Análisis y herramientas de monitoreo:

4.1 Herramientas para analizar horas trabajadas, incidencias, y otros datos de asistencia.
4.2 Capacidad para crear informes dinámicos y fáciles de interpretar para la toma de decisiones.

5. Interfaz de usuario amigable y funcional:

5.1 Diseño intuitivo y fácil de usar tanto en desktop como en móviles.
5.2 Compatible con Oracle APEX para asegurar la integración y optimización en el entorno empresarial.

Requisitos adicionales:

Zona horaria y disponibilidad: El freelancer debe tener un horario de trabajo compatible con la zona horaria (UTC -5) Sudamerica y estar disponible durante las horas laborales en la región para facilitar la comunicación en tiempo real y el desarrollo ágil del proyecto.

Entrega de documentación completa: El freelancer deberá entregar toda la documentación técnica del proyecto, incluyendo los programas fuentes para su implementación, actualización y mantenimiento posterior.

Capacitación técnica: Se requiere que el freelancer proporcione una capacitación técnica al lider técnico del proyecto para asegurar el correcto uso, administración y mantenimiento del sistema.

Análisis de Requerimientos: Se adjunta un archivo con las especificaciones detalladas del análisis de requerimientos, el cual servirá como guía para el desarrollo de la solución. Este archivo contiene información clave sobre las funcionalidades y características necesarias para adaptar el sistema a nuestras necesidades específicas.

Perfil buscado:

- Experiencia demostrable en Oracle APEX.
- Conocimiento en integración de dispositivos de proximidad y control por GPS.
- De preferencia con experiencia en desarrollo de sistemas de control de asistencia y generación de informes de recursos humanos.
- Capacidad para personalizar soluciones según las necesidades específicas de cada empresa.
- Disponibilidad para trabajar en horarios compatibles con la zona horaria de Sudamerica (UTC -5).

Otros aspectos relevantes:

- Alcance del proyecto:

  El proyecto se desarrollará en fases, comenzando con la implementación de funcionalidades básicas, seguido por el desarrollo de reportes e integración de dispositivos, etc.
  El freelancer deberá cumplir con plazos establecidos, con entregas parciales para revisión y validación de avances.

- Requisitos técnicos:

  El sistema se desarrollará sobre Oracle APEX, y deberá integrarse con bases de datos de Oracle, considerando la integración con sistemas de recursos humanos y otras herramientas corporativas existentes.

- Metodología de trabajo:

  El freelancer debe estar familiarizado con metodologías ágiles (Scrum o Kanban) para la entrega continua y ajustes iterativos a lo largo del proyecto.

- Criterios de selección:

  De preferencia con experiencia en desarrollo de sistemas de control de asistencia, especialmente con Oracle APEX.
  Enfoque práctico en la creación de reportes e informes personalizados.
  Ejemplos previos de proyectos relacionados y un portafolio que demuestre habilidades técnicas y capacidad para entregar soluciones a medida.

- Presupuesto y condiciones de pago:

  El presupuesto es negociable dependiendo de la experiencia y el enfoque propuesto.
  El pago se realizará por hitos de entrega, con pagos parciales después de cada fase completada y una compensación final tras la entrega y capacitación.
 
- Aspectos legales y confidencialidad:

  El freelancer deberá firmar un acuerdo de confidencialidad (NDA) para proteger la información sensible durante el desarrollo y una vez finalizado el proyecto.
  Propiedad intelectual: Toda la propiedad intelectual generada durante el proyecto será de propiedad de la empresa al concluir el trabajo y recibir el pago final.

Si eres un experto en Oracle APEX y tienes experiencia en el desarrollo de sistemas de control de asistencia con funcionalidades avanzadas de monitoreo y análisis, nos encantaría conocer tu perfil.

Por favor, comparte ejemplos de proyectos previos relacionados y tu propuesta para abordar este desarrollo.

¡Esperamos tu postulación!

Contexto general del proyecto

### **Contexto General del Proyecto: Desarrollo de Aplicación de Control de Asistencia en Oracle APEX** El objetivo de este proyecto es desarrollar una **aplicación de control de asistencia de personal** para una empresa que busca optimizar y automatizar la gestión del registro de asistencia de sus empleados. La aplicación debe ser flexible y personalizable, adaptándose a las necesidades específicas de la empresa, que incluyen diferentes métodos de control de acceso (tarjetas de proximidad, dispositivos biométricos y dispositivos móviles con GPS) y un sistema de generación de reportes detallados sobre la asistencia, horas trabajadas, incidencias y otras métricas clave. Actualmente, la empresa enfrenta desafíos relacionados con el **seguimiento automátizado de la asistencia** y la **falta de precisión** en el control de los tiempos de trabajo, lo cual puede generar errores en los registros de entrada/salida, cambios de turno, y otros eventos clave del día a día laboral. El desarrollo de este sistema pretende resolver esos problemas mediante la automatización de los procesos, asegurando que los registros sean **precisos, transparentes y accesibles** en tiempo real para los gerentes y el equipo de recursos humanos. El sistema también debe ofrecer herramientas de análisis que permitan realizar un seguimiento de las **tardanzas**, **ausencias**, **horas extras** y **otros aspectos relevantes** de la asistencia laboral. Estos informes no solo deben ser fáciles de interpretar, sino también generar alertas automáticas para incidencias recurrentes y proporcionar datos que ayuden a mejorar la toma de decisiones a nivel de recursos humanos. ### **Aspectos Clave del Proyecto**: 1. **Objetivos Funcionales**: - Registro preciso del **ingreso y salida** de los empleados. - Control de los **tiempos de refrigerio**, **cambios de sección** y **turno**. - **Generación de reportes** detallados sobre asistencia, tardanzas, horas trabajadas, y otras incidencias. - Adaptación a las necesidades específicas de la empresa, como el uso de **tarjetas de proximidad**, **dispositivos biométricos** para los empleados en las plantas y el uso de **dispositivos móviles** con **coordenadas GPS** para los empleados en las tiendas. 2. **Requerimientos Técnicos**: - Desarrollar el sistema utilizando **Oracle APEX**, garantizando una integración eficaz con las bases de datos existentes de la empresa. - La solución debe ser accesible tanto desde dispositivos **móviles** como **de escritorio**, con una interfaz amigable y fácil de usar. - El sistema debe estar configurado para la **zona horaria de Sudamerica Perú (UTC -5)**, para asegurar la precisión de los registros. 3. **Expectativas de Implementación**: - Se requerirá un **desarrollo por fases**, con entregas parciales para revisión y retroalimentación continua. - Además de la entrega del código fuente, se deberá proporcionar una **documentación técnica completa**, incluyendo manuales de usuario y de implementación. - El **soporte post-lanzamiento** será necesario para solucionar posibles problemas y realizar ajustes. 4. **Beneficios Esperados**: - **Precisión** en los registros de entrada y salida. - Mejora en el **seguimiento de las incidencias** (como tardanzas o ausencias). - **Reducción de errores** en la generación de reportes y nómina. - Herramientas de **análisis avanzadas** para optimizar la gestión de tiempo laboral. - **Mayor eficiencia operativa** y ahorro de tiempo en la administración de personal. 5. **Impacto Esperado en la Empresa**: El nuevo sistema permitirá que la empresa tenga un control más estricto y automatizado de la asistencia laboral, lo que contribuirá a una mayor transparencia y a la optimización de los procesos de recursos humanos. Los datos recopilados por el sistema se utilizarán para tomar decisiones más informadas sobre la gestión del personal y para mejorar la productividad y la puntualidad de los empleados. Este proyecto de **desarrollo de la aplicación de control de asistencia** no solo resolverá los problemas actuales de la empresa en cuanto al registro manual y los errores de cálculo, sino que también proporcionará una base sólida para futuras mejoras en la gestión de los recursos humanos mediante el uso de tecnologías avanzadas y sistemas integrados.

Categoría Programación y Tecnología
Subcategoría Programación Web
¿Cuál es el alcance del proyecto? Cambio mediano
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o las especificaciones
Disponibilidad requerida Según se necesite
Roles necesarios Programador

Plazo de Entrega: No definido

Habilidades necesarias

Otros proyectos publicados por G. P.